Hoop action thrills crowds Tornado basketball a la 1969- 70 featured more than the usual thrills and surprises. The relatively inexperienced team gained poise as the season progressed and every week-end seemed to find a different hero. Although Tri-Valley was destined to win the M,V.L. crown, the West Tornadoes gave the Scotties their hardest game of the season. New this year was the addition of the Tornado Club and the enlarged Pep Band to augment the always present school spirit. 26 Clever skzts zgnzte pep This year's cheerleaders worked with the Pep Club, Y-Teens, and GAA to write and present pep assembly skits that entertained and ignited enthusiasm for the coming basketball games. Some of the more successful skits featured a brawny beauty contest, a tricycle escapade, an interview with various town citizens, and a presentation of blue and gold towels to members of the varsity squad. West faculty smashes OUZ On December 18, the West Muskingum Faculty polished off the Faculty of Ohio University at Zanesville by a 55-33 margin. Scoring leaders were Mr. Kendall with 11, Mr. Zechiel with 9, and Mr. Fugate with 7 points. The Tornado Teachers opened up a first quarter margin, but saw it vanish as the score was knotted at halftime. It was not until the second half that West got rolling and smothered the visitors with a barage of assorted patterns and shots. Mr. Bardall accomplishes a fabulous hook shot.
